The part in Roam The Room that goes "I want to know what I've been fighting for, I wanna know what I've become" reminds me a lot of the line from Gasoline by Brand New that says "I wanna know I've left the great divide, I wanna know what I've become". The melody even sounds similar, and since Mat is a Brand New fanboy I'd guess that it's not a coincidence.
